וובמאסטר - תיכנות ובניית אתרים

הנגשת אתרים בוורדפרס

dzrihen/‏ 13 דצמבר, 2017
F+
F-

החוק להנגשת אתרי אינטרנט תפס לא מעט בעלי אתרים לא מוכנים, במיוחד את אלו שהשתמשו באתרים הבנויים על מערכת ניהול תוכן מותאמת אישית (ויש עדיין לא מעט אתרים כאלו).

הנגשת אתרים עולה בקנה אחד גם עם קידום אתרים, שכן ישנן הרבה פעולות חופפות בין 2 התחומים כמו למשל כותרות 1H, אלטים לתמונות, טקסטים בולטים וקריאים גם למשתמשים וגם למנועי חיפוש ועוד.

למרבה המזל, מי שמשתמש במערכת הניהול וורדפרס או מתכוון לעבור אליה, יכול לבצע חלק לא קטן ממלאכת ההנגשה בעצמו: כיום קיימים לא מעט תוספים טובים מאוד שחלקם פותחו בארץ ולכן הם המתאימים ביותר לוורדפרס (בניגוד לתוספים ג'נרים שצריכים לספק פתרון לאתרים עם תשתיות שונות לחלוטין).

בכל מקרה, חשוב לזכור שלא מספיק להשתמש בתוסף על מנת להגיע לרמת AA שנדרשת בחוק, ויש פעולות שחייבים לבצע באופן ידני (נדון על כך בהמשך).

תוספים מומלצים שפותחו בישראל ותומכים בעברית באופן מלא:

WAH - WordPress Accessibility Helper

מדובר באחד התוספים היותר מתקדמים עם רשימת תכונות ארוכה במיוחד. מלבד שינוי גודל הפונט והפונט עצמו, הוא תומך גם בשינוי הצבעים באתר, מכיל כלי לבדיקת ניגודיות והוספת קו תחתון לקישורים או צבע רקע על מנת להדגיש אותם ועוד.
ישנה גם גרסת פרו עם פאנל יפה יותר שניתן לעצב ואפשרות לשמור את הגדרות המשתמש לכל עמוד בנפרד באמצעות Cookies.

עוד פרטים תוכלו לקרוא בעמוד הרשמי שלו בספריית התוספים של וורדפרס.

Accessible Poetry

פאנל הניהול של Poetry מעוצב בצורה מעט אסתטית יותר מהפאנל בגרסת הבסיס של WAH. הוא תומך בכל התכונות הבסיסיות כגון שינוי גודל גופן, שליטה בניגודיות (מצב בהיר וכהה), הדגשת קישורים, שינוי גופן וביטול אנימציות.

enable

תוסף זה דורש רישום לצורך קבלת מפתח הפעלה, אך יש לו מבחר מרשים של תכונות ייחודיות כגון פלטות צבעים ספציפיות לעיוורי צבעים בעלי לקויות שונות, הדגשת כותרת וכותרות משנה, הגדלת סמן העכבר בתוך הדפדפן ומעבר נוח לגרסת הדפסה.

SOGO Accessibility

SOGO הוא תוסף קל ונוח מאוד לשימוש, אבל מספר התכונות שלו הוא יחסית מוגבל לעומת התוספים האחרים. כמו כן, הוא מכיל קישור לאתר של היוצר, ואם רוצים להסיר את הקישור, יש לקנות מנוי שנתי בהתאם למספר האתרים בהם רוצים להשתמש בו.

אמצעי הנגשה נוספים

כאמור, התוספים עצמם לא עונים על דרישות הנגישות ברמה AA בצורה המלאה. הסיבה לכך היא לא בהכרח טכנית, אלא קשורה גם לתוכן של האתר. התוסף יכול אמנם לבצע בדיקה ולהתריע על אלמנטים לא נגישים, אבל את העבודה צריך בסופו של דבר לעשות בעל האתר או עורך התוכן שלו.

למשל, אם רוצים לספק חלופה טקסטואלית לתמונות, יש לערוך כל טקסט כזה בנפרד. באופן דומה, תמלול של קטע וידאו או הוספת כתוביות בתוך הסרט הם מעבר ליכולות של התוסף והם תלויים למעשה בנגן הווידאו הספציפי בו עושים שימוש (למרבה המזל, הנגן הסטנדרטי של יו-טיוב עונה על הדרישות הללו).

גם העיצוב הבסיסי של האתר חייב להיות נגיש, החל מסידור הכותרות והתת כותרות ועד לריווח בין הפסקאות והתמונות. אפילו לטקסט הקישורים יש השפעה על גולשים מסוימים ועדיף שהוא לא יהיה סתמי ("לחץ כאן").

לבסוף, יש להיזהר בהוספת מבנים מורכבים כמו אלו שניתן למצוא ב- Page Builders מכיוון שהם מוסיפים קטעי קוד חיצוניים שלא תמיד ניתן לקרוא אותם היטב באמצעות קורא המסך. לדוגמה, טבלאות, מצגת תמונות אוטומטית וכך הלאה. בנוסף, צריך לבדוק שהם לא שוברים את תקינות קוד ה- HTML (אמנם קשה מאוד לבנות אתרים תקינים ב-100%, אך צריך לשאוף לאחוז תקינות כמה שיותר גבוה).

שימוש בתוספים חיצוניים

לעיתים קרובות, נעשה באתרי וורדפרס שימוש בתוספים חיצונים על מנת ליישם תכונות כמו הוספת טפסים, בדיקות Captcha, בדיקת תקינות של הקוד וכך הלאה. במקרים האלו, יש לבדוק שהתוספים עצמם תומכים בתכונות הנגישות. לעיתים ניתן לחבר תוספים עם תוספים אחרים, אך לעיתים יש להשתמש במתכנת שיבצע את השינויים (לדוגמה, כאשר יש להוסיף עזרי קלט לטפסים).

טיפ נוסף לסיום

אין מה לעשות, והנגשה של אתרים קיימים, במיוחד אתרים גדולים ומורכבים היא משימה לא פשוטה. מצד שני, כאשר בונים אתר חדש או משנים אתר קיים מן היסוד (משתמשים רק במידע מתוך בסיס הנתונים בתבנית חדשה), יש לחשוב על נגישות כבר בתהליך בניית האתר : ישנן תבניות רבות בוורדפרס שהן כל כך מורכבות, עד שצריך מתכנת של ממש על מנת לתפעל אותן כמו שצריך (במיוחד באתרים בעברית והעובדה שהתמיכה ב- RTL בתבניות מתורגמות היא לא תמיד מלאה).

אגב, אף על פי מסע ההפחדות של חלק מן החברות לבניית אתרים, כנראה שאף אחד לא יתבע אתכם אם האתר שלכם לא יהיה נגיש לחלוטין משום שהגשת תביעה היא לא עניין של מה בכך, אבל הנגשת אתר מאפס מאפשרת להנגיש את האתר גם לבעלי מוגבלויות חמורות וכך להגדיל את מספר הגולשים הרלוונטיים שיכנסו לאתר.

dzrihen

מקדם אתרים וכותב בלוג מקצועי בנושא
תגיות: WordPress‏  /  נגישות‏  /  וורדפרס‏  

תגובות בפייסבוק

תגובות למאמר



תגיות פופולאריות

X
הצטרף לעמוד שלנו בפייסבוק להישאר מעודכן!
וובמאסטר © כל הזכויות שמורות